The lobby manager, sweating bullets under the pressure, climbed onto a chair, holding a megaphone.
Thank you all for your passion and patience, but please, line up in an orderly fashion! We dont want any accidents here.
Drinks and pastries are also available here! he called out, trying to maintain order amidst the chaos.
Despite his towering frame and the muscles that strained against his suit, his tone was surprisingly soft, a far cry from the arrogant, aloof attitude he had displayed when he had first met Ariana.
Just then, the CEOs exclusive elevators doors slid open with a quiet ding, and out walked Holden, flanked by his subordinates.
The lobby managers sharp eyes caught Holdens entrance immediately.
Without a second thought, he handed the megaphone to a nearby employee and rushed over to Holden.
Holden was in the middle of listening to a report on the companys latest operations when the lobby managers sudden appearance derailed his train of thought.
He frowned in slight irritation.
Mr.
Fredrick! Here to see Miss Edwards? the lobby manager asked, oblivious to the dark cloud of displeasure forming on Holdens face.
He pointed toward the long line of people. Miss Edwards is still busy.
Look at that crowd-theyre waiting for the artist draft.
The line stretches all the way to the lobby! Sensing Holdens rising annoyance, Devin quickly stepped forward and pulled the manager aside.
The CEOs got a lot on his plate right now, Devin whispered.
Why dont you head over to finance later? You can get your bonus there.
The lobby managers face lit up at the mention of a bonus.
With a wide grin, he watched Holden leave before rushing back to his post.
The lobby buzzed with anticipation, voices and footsteps echoing off the high ceilings.
A petite young woman with bright eyes and a hint of nervousness squeezed through the crowd, finally escaping outside to dial a number.

Im here already.
Where are you? Just then, a gentle hand rested on her back.
Milly, Im here, said a familiar voice, breathless.
Sorry, traffic was a nightmare.The person who had just come was Marlowe.
Marlowe knew how much this audition meant to Milly-a shy girl who had always marveled at the way performers sparkled on stage.
Millys admiration for stars ran deep, but social situations drained her, so Marlowe had taken a day off work to accompany Milly for the audition.
I was worried you couldnt make it, Milly said, slipping her phone back into her pocket and looping her arm through Marlowes.
Marlowe squeezed her arm reassuringly.
Id never break a promise to you.
Come on, we should hurry and get in line.
There are so many people here.
With a nod, Milly let herself be guided inside, clinging to Marlowes steady presence.
Thirty minutes later, it was finally Millys turn to fill out the registration form.
She hesitated before picking up the pen.
Turning to Marlowe, she said, Are you sure you dont want to fill out a form, too? Youd definitely get in-youre gorgeous. Marlowe chuckled and shook her head.
This companys all about singing and dancing, and thats not really my thing, she said.
Im holding out for acting roles, even if its just a small part.
Thats where I want to be.
Milly nodded in understanding.
You know, it might be easier if you signed with an agency.
Whether its acting or singing, they could help boost your popularity.
Doing this all on your own… Its hard.
Marlowe shrugged.
Maybe.
We can talk about this later.
Once Milly handed in her form, an employee in a dark suit guided Milly and Marlowe to the audition area.
